Specimen number RSA798471
Determination Rumex acetosella
More information: Jepson Online Interchange
Collector, number, date D. H. Wilken, E. Painter, E. Neese, L. Metz, HL- 2459, 1996-4-6
Verbatim date 1996-04-06
County Monterey
Locality Fort Hunter Liggett (Training Area 3), old home site, ca. 1.2 km west of Pine point [horizontal control station (VABM) point [elevation 933 m] in Oats Hills, ca. 2.8 air km NNW of Cosio Knob.
Elevation 750m
HabitatAbandoned field, small stream, and wet meadow in disturbed oak-pine savanna. Loamy clay.

NotesInfrequent. Perennial. Rhizomatous. Erect, to 5 dm tall. Perianth yellow-green to reddish. Associates: Quercus douglasii, Q. agrifolia, Pinus sabiniana, Erodium botrys, Lupinus, Bromus hordeaceus, Geranium dissectum, Avena.;
